Mentzelia multicaulis var. uintahensis

Mentzelia multicaulis (Osterh.) A. Nelson ex J. Darl. var. uintahensis N.H. Holmgren & P.K. Holmgren

Uinta Basin Stickleaf, Uintah Blazing Star, Uintah Blazingstar

Loasaceae (Loasa family)

Synonym(s):

USDA Symbol: MEMUU

USDA Native Status: L48 (N)

 

From the Image Gallery

No images of this plant

Plant Characteristics

Duration: Perennial
Habit: Subshrub
Fruit Type: Capsule
Size Notes: Up to about 1 foot tall.

Bloom Information

Bloom Color: Yellow
Bloom Time: May , Jun , Jul , Aug , Sep

Distribution

USA: CO , UT
Native Habitat: Sparsely vegetated steep talus slopes and roadcuts.
